Statistical power is important in a meta-analysis study, although few studies have examined the performance of simulated power in meta-analysis. The purpose of this study is to inform researchers about statistical power estimation on two sample mean difference test under different situations: (1) the discrepancy between the analytical power and the actual power and (2) the influence of unequal sample size and unbalanced design on the power. Results indicated that there are noticeable discrepancies between the estimated power and actual power under certain conditions. In general, unbalanced design decreases the statistical power in the meta-analysis. Recommendations are provided for researchers …

This dissertation is comprised of three manuscripts, to be submitted for publication, exploring the use of simulation in geriatric nursing education. The first manuscript is a literature review. Although, a number of articles exist on the use of simulation in nursing education, there is a paucity of research using simulation emphasizing the care of patients with dementia and delirium as a pedagogical strategy or those using a stringent research design.
The second manuscript provides an overview of two conceptual frameworks (National League for Nursing (NLN)/Jeffries Simulation Framework and situated cognition learning framework) and recommends merging them to guide researchers as …
